Julia Ann Baxter was born in 1831 in Baltimore, Maryland, USA, the child of John Baxter And Eve Ann Dell. Julia Ann Baxter married James Franklin Gaunt, and had children including Noah Von Gaunt. Julia Ann Baxter passed away in 1903 in Great Bend, Barton County, Kansas.
